About The Role

An exciting opportunity has arisen to join the team in the Forest of Dean as a Library Assistant. We are looking for dynamic individual with a sense of fun to help develop what we offer to our customers.

Our Library Assistants are the public face of the Library Service, making sure that our customers have access to all of the services that libraries provide.

This will include helping them choose and issue books, maintaining the stock in the library, signposting to advice services and providing children’s activities. We’re looking for someone who can work independently and with colleagues and volunteers, handle money and think on their feet.

The Position Is 30.5 Hours Per Week, Working Between Newent (NT) And Cinderford (CD) Libraries On a 2-week Rota. Example Timetable

Week 1: Monday 1-7 (NT), Tuesday OFF, Wednesday 10-5 (CD), Thursday 10-5 (NT), Friday 9.30-7 (NT), and Saturday 10-2 (NT)

Week 2: Monday OFF, Tuesday 10-5 (NT), Wednesday 10-5 (CD), Thursday 10-5 (NT), Friday 10-7 (NT) and Saturday 9.30-2 (NT)
